How they compare

Papua New Guinea currently reports 37,386 against 36,954 in Yemen, a difference of 432.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2017 it was Papua New Guinea ahead.

Papua New Guinea ranks 36th and Yemen ranks 37th of 160 countries.

Papua New Guinea has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
